Icon of Style - Perry Farrell



Everybody wishes they could get away with dressing like a rock star.  It takes some serious balls to pull off...that, and a whimsical fashion sense mixed with the practical sensibilities of a biker.  That being said...some rock 'n' rollers go the other way, and manage to pull off the sophisticated look of the dandy and still keep themselves away from androgyny. Perry Farrell, the founder and front man for such great groups like Jane's Addiction, Porno for Pyros and Satellite Party has always had a style of his own, and with time and age he has managed to keep improving on his style rather than clinging to the look of his hey days (a notable pitfall in the aging music scene). That in itself says a great deal about the progressive leanings that Mr. Farrell has, but to add to that; fashion Juggernaut John Varvatos thought Perry's look was so interesting, he was picked for the 2008 Varvatos advertising campaign.  We'll just let the pictures speak for themselves, of which there are more of after the jump.
